Hedge fund manager, activist investor Bill Ackman made money shorting financials in 2008. He said that he takes activist position to make the company better, and realize the full business value. This is the Q3 portfolio update of his investment company, Pershing Square.

Bill Ackman buys Corrections Corp. Of America New during the 3-months ended 09/30/2009, according to the most recent filings of his investment company, Pershing Square Capital Management, L.P.. Bill Ackman owns 7 stocks with a total value of $3.1 billion. These are the details of the buys and sells.

  • New Purchases: CXW,

  • Added Positions: MCD, TGT,

These are the top 5 holdings of Bill Ackman

  1. Target Corp. (TGT) - 26,012,799 shares, 38.8% of the total portfolio

  2. EMC Corp. (EMC) - 58,678,780 shares, 31.95% of the total portfolio

  3. McDonald's Corp. (MCD) - 8,245,412 shares, 15.04% of the total portfolio

  4. Automatic Data Processing Inc. (ADP) - 6,118,353 shares, 7.68% of the total portfolio

  5. Corrections Corp. Of America New (CXW) - 7,355,620 shares, 5.32% of the total portfolio



Added: Mcdonald's Corp. (MCD, Financial)

Bill Ackman added to his holdings in Mcdonald's Corp. by 243.56%. His purchase prices were between $54.23 and $58.82, with an estimated average price of $56.25. The impact to his portfolio due to this purchase was 10.66%. His holdings were 8,245,412 shares as of 09/30/2009.

Mcdonald's Corp. has a market cap of $70.42 billion; its shares were traded at around $64.53 with a P/E ratio of 16.9 and P/S ratio of 3. The dividend yield of Mcdonald's Corp. stocks is 3.1%. Mcdonald's Corp. had an annual average earning growth of 7.2% over the past 10 years.

Added: Target Corp. (TGT, Financial)

Bill Ackman added to his holdings in Target Corp. by 4.58%. His purchase prices were between $36.75 and $48.84, with an estimated average price of $43.76. The impact to his portfolio due to this purchase was 1.7%. His holdings were 26,012,799 shares as of 09/30/2009.

Target Corp. has a market cap of $37.81 billion; its shares were traded at around $50.29 with a P/E ratio of 18.1 and P/S ratio of 0.6. The dividend yield of Target Corp. stocks is 1.4%. Target Corp. had an annual average earning growth of 11.6% over the past 10 years. GuruFocus rated Target Corp. the business predictability rank of 5-star.

New Purchase: Corrections Corp. Of America New (CXW, Financial)

Bill Ackman initiated holdings in Corrections Corp. Of America New. His purchase prices were between $16 and $22.78, with an estimated average price of $19.4. The impact to his portfolio due to this purchase was 5.32%. His holdings were 7,355,620 shares as of 09/30/2009.

Corrections Corporation of America Company is the one of nation's largest providers of detention and corrections services to governmental agencies. The company is one of the industry leaders in private sector corrections with beds in facilities under contract for management in the United States and Puerto Rico. The company's full range of services includes design, construction, ownership, renovation and management of new or existing jails and prisons, as well as long distance inmate transportation services. (Company Press Release) Corrections Corp. Of America New has a market cap of $2.9 billion; its shares were traded at around $25.19 with a P/E ratio of 20.3 and P/S ratio of 1.8. Corrections Corp. Of America New had an annual average earning growth of 7% over the past 5 years
